全场景多端适配建站架构实战解析
|
在当前互联网应用快速迭代的背景下,全场景多端适配已成为建站的核心需求。用户不再局限于桌面浏览器,而是通过手机、平板、智能电视甚至可穿戴设备访问内容。传统的单一布局或响应式设计已无法满足多样化的终端体验要求,因此构建一套能够覆盖全场景、适配多端的建站架构,成为提升用户体验与运营效率的关键。 全场景多端适配的核心在于“统一内容,差异化呈现”。这意味着站点的基础内容结构保持一致,但前端展示逻辑需根据设备类型、屏幕尺寸、交互方式等动态调整。例如,移动端强调触控友好与快速加载,而桌面端则可承载更复杂的交互组件。这种分层设计避免了重复开发,同时保证了内容的一致性与体验的精准性。 实现这一目标,关键在于采用模块化与组件化的设计思想。通过将页面拆分为可复用的原子组件(如导航栏、卡片、表单等),并为每个组件定义不同终端下的渲染规则,系统可在运行时自动选择最合适的版本。结合CSS媒体查询与JavaScript运行时检测,前端框架能智能识别设备特性,动态加载对应样式与行为逻辑。 技术选型上,现代前端框架如React、Vue 3和Next.js提供了强大的服务端渲染(SSR)与静态生成(SSG)能力。借助这些能力,站点可以在服务端根据不同请求头判断客户端类型,提前生成适合该设备的HTML内容,极大提升首屏加载速度与搜索引擎优化效果。同时,通过使用PWA(渐进式网页应用)技术,还能让网站在移动端具备类似原生应用的离线访问与推送通知功能。
AI设计图示,仅供参考 数据层面,前后端分离架构配合API网关,使内容与展示解耦。后端统一提供标准化的数据接口,前端根据终端特性调用相应接口或对数据进行轻量化处理。例如,移动端可能仅需基础字段,而大屏设备则可获取富媒体扩展信息。这种灵活的数据适配机制,增强了系统的可维护性与扩展性。 运维方面,基于CI/CD流水线的自动化部署体系,支持多环境、多分支的并行发布。每次更新可针对特定终端进行灰度测试,确保新功能在不同设备上的稳定性。结合监控与日志分析工具,开发团队能快速定位并修复跨端兼容问题。 本站观点,全场景多端适配并非简单的“适配”,而是一套融合设计、架构、开发与运维的系统工程。只有以用户为中心,以技术为支撑,才能真正实现“一处开发,处处可用”的高效建站模式,为产品长期发展奠定坚实基础。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

